Output 3d012efa8660093f0ed6dea51ab3abb10a05002deb706a7bfd0d485f6bb5fa77:1

value
2321797
script pubkey
OP_0 OP_PUSHBYTES_20 eca18e4363b7ed65b50af07d4a7c3f40f16c00b4
address
bc1qajscusmrklkktdg27p755lplgrckcq95ydyduh
transaction
3d012efa8660093f0ed6dea51ab3abb10a05002deb706a7bfd0d485f6bb5fa77
confirmations
131973
spent
true